Erreur lors du téléchargement via ftp (php)

sirinatou88 -  
Flachy Joe Messages postés 2102 Date d'inscription   Statut Membre Dernière intervention   -
je voudrais télécharger via ftp des fichiers qui existe déjà dans un répertoire dans le serveur ftp. mon script me génère toujours l'erreur suivante: no such file in directory...
j'ai vérifier bien fichiers et mon répertoire, je ne comprends pas où est l'erreur
voici mon scipt:

<?php
//connexion ftp
{ script de connexion }

// Téléchargement d'un fichier.
if(isset($var1))
{

ftp_get($conn_id, "C:/", "./Upload/.$var1", FTP_BINARY);
}
ftp_close($conn_id);
?>

$var1 est le com du fichier que je voudrais télécharger
A voir également:

1 réponse

Flachy Joe Messages postés 2102 Date d'inscription   Statut Membre Dernière intervention   261
 
Salut !
"./Upload/.$var1"
C'est normal le point avant $var1 ? Tu voulais pas faire ça plutôt :
'./Upload/'.$var1
ou (moins performant)
"./Upload/$var1"
;-) Flachy Joe ;-)
0
sirinatou88
 
Merci flashy , mais ça me génère tjs cette erreur :
failed to open stream: No such file or directory in C:\wamp\www\2\telecharger.php on line 26

je veux concaténer le path "./uploads/" avec la variable $var1.
par exp si j'ai $var1=liste.txt ,mon chemin sera "./uploads/liste.txt (c'est un chemin relatif)
0
Flachy Joe Messages postés 2102 Date d'inscription   Statut Membre Dernière intervention   261
 
Va faire un tour par là, ça sera sûrement plus clair pour toi :
https://www.php.net/manual/fr/language.operators.string.php
0